"Great benefits for FT employees, moderate pay, overall good place to work"

What do you like about working at Traco?

"Personal and non-bureaucratic; executives and directors are visible and accessible; 'worker bees' are hard-working and friendly (for the most part)"

Do you have any tips for others interviewing with this company?

"TRACO and ex-TRACO folks are well-represented on LinkedIn; if you don't know anyone from this company, you may be able to contact them by joining LinkedIn industry groups such as Fenestration Nation, Doors & Windows Manufacturers Group, etc."

What don't you like about working at Traco?

"The company is a bit process-chaotic, which in itself is not a bad thing (especially if your expertise is in implementing process improvements) ... but the resistance to change from the grass-roots to the ivory tower is significant. TRACO has been improving significantly in this area, but needs to remain consistent and focused."

What suggestions do you have for management?

"Make significant steps now to eliminate corporate ADHD. In other words, follow through on strategic initiatives and don't be distracted by every stormy wind of change in the market and change course multiple times mid-stream. Don't settle for the mere appearance of improvement; learn who can frankly tell you accurately whether the gem you've got is a diamond, a cubic zirconia, or just a broken piece of glass, and build their trust."
